OVERVIEW North Carolina State Education Assistance Authority's series 2012-1 issuance is an ABS securitization backed by student loans that are at least 97% federally reinsured by the U.S. federal government. We assigned our 'AA+ (sf)' rating to the class A notes. The 'AA+ (sf)' rating reflects our view of the transaction's initial expected parity and the federal government's reinsurance of at least 97% of the loan's principal and interest, among other factors. NEW YORK (Standard&Poor's) Aug. 23, 2012--Standard&Poor's Ratings Services today assigned its 'AA+ (sf)' rating to North Carolina State Education Assistance Authority's $600.0 million student loan-backed notes series 2012-1.
